Fuzzy Logic Based Dynamic Load Balancing in Virtualized Data Centers

被引:4
作者
Nine, Md. S. Q. Zulkar [1 ]
Azad, Md. Abul Kalam [1 ]
Abdullah, Saad [1 ]
Rahman, Rashedur M. [1 ]
机构
[1] North South Univ, Dept Elect Engn & Comp Sci, Plot 15,Block B, Dhaka 1229, Bangladesh
来源
2013 IEEE INTERNATIONAL CONFERENCE ON FUZZY SYSTEMS (FUZZ - IEEE 2013) | 2013年
关键词
Cloud Computing; Dynamic Load Balancing; Type-I Fuzzy Systems; SaaS; CLOUD COMPUTING ENVIRONMENTS;
D O I
10.1109/FUZZ-IEEE.2013.6622384
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Cloud Computing helps to provide quality of service to the end users within required time frame. Serving user requests using distributed network of virtualized data centers is a challenging task as response time increases significantly without a proper load balancing strategy. There are many algorithms proposed in the literature to support load balancing in cloud environment. All of them have their merits and demerits. The inherent structure of load balancing is rather imprecise. In this research, we model the imprecise requirements of memory, bandwidth and disk space through the use of fuzzy logic. Then we design and evaluate an efficient dynamic fuzzy load balancing algorithm which could efficiently predict the virtual machine where the next job will be scheduled. We implement a cloud model in simulation environment and compare the result of our novel approach with existing techniques. Simulation results demonstrate that our fuzzy algorithm outperforms other scheduling algorithms with respect to response time, data center processing time, etc.
引用
收藏
页数:7
相关论文
共 10 条
  • [1] Buyya Rajkumar, 2009, 2009 International Conference on High Performance Computing & Simulation (HPCS), P1, DOI 10.1109/HPCSIM.2009.5192685
  • [2] Cloud computing and emerging IT platforms: Vision, hype, and reality for delivering computing as the 5th utility
    Buyya, Rajkumar
    Yeo, Chee Shin
    Venugopal, Srikumar
    Broberg, James
    Brandic, Ivona
    [J]. F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2009, 25 (06): : 599 - 616
  • [3] CloudSim: a toolkit for modeling and simulation of cloud computing environments and evaluation of resource provisioning algorithms
    Calheiros, Rodrigo N.
    Ranjan, Rajiv
    Beloglazov, Anton
    De Rose, Cesar A. F.
    Buyya, Rajkumar
    [J]. SOFTWARE-PRACTICE & EXPERIENCE, 2011, 41 (01) : 23 - 50
  • [4] Klir G, 1995, FUZZY SETS FUZZY LOG, V4
  • [5] Efficient dynamic task scheduling in virtualized data centers with fuzzy prediction
    Kong, Xiangzhen
    Lin, Chuang
    Jiang, Yixin
    Yan, Wei
    Chu, Xiaowen
    [J]. J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2011, 34 (04) : 1068 - 1077
  • [6] Kumar V.V., 2012, BONFRING INT J MAN M, V2, P1
  • [7] EXPERIMENT IN LINGUISTIC SYNTHESIS WITH A FUZZY LOGIC CONTROLLER
    MAMDANI, EH
    ASSILIAN, S
    [J]. INTERNATIONAL JOURNAL OF MAN-MACHINE STUDIES, 1975, 7 (01): : 1 - 13
  • [8] CloudAnalyst: A CloudSim-based Visual Modeller for Analysing Cloud Computing Environments and Applications
    Wickremasinghe, Bhathiya
    Calheiros, Rodrigo N.
    Buyya, Rajkumar
    [J]. 2010 24TH IEEE INTERNATIONAL CONFERENCE ON ADVANCED INFORMATION NETWORKING AND APPLICATIONS (AINA), 2010, : 446 - 452
  • [9] Yagoubi B., 2008, AFR C RES COMP SCI A, P631
  • [10] FUZZY SETS
    ZADEH, LA
    [J]. INFORMATION AND CONTROL, 1965, 8 (03): : 338 - &